What they do
A Busser, Banquet Worker, or Cafeteria Attendant assists with food service at a restaurant, large banquet hall or cafeteria. Removes used dishes, sets tables with clean dishes and linens, replenishes foods served at food stations or buffet tables, and provides water, coffee or other beverages for patrons.

Job Description
High school diploma or GED. Post-secondary training in food service or closely related field is desirable Meets all mandated health requirements. A record free of criminal violations that would prohibit public school employment. Complies with drug-free workplace rules and board policies. Willing to keep current with advances in equipment and technology that supports job function. Congenial disposition and strong diplomacy skills
